Just watched I Love You Now Die on HBO. 2 part doc on a really fascinating and disturbing case in Massachusetts about the girl who persuaded her boyfriend by text messaging to kill himself. It's much more complicated than the sensational headlines and the doc does a good job illuminating the nuances. Tragic all around and a thoroughly contemporary and complex legal case.
